Lawrence Taylor T Shirt Overview

A Lawrence Taylor t shirt refers to officially licensed and fan-made apparel featuring the retired NFL linebacker Lawrence Taylor. The merchandise typically includes his jersey number 56, the New York Giants logo, and career milestones such as his 1986 NFL MVP award. Retailers and sports apparel brands sell these shirts through e-commerce platforms and official team stores. The market for Lawrence Taylor t shirts remains active among NFL memorabilia collectors and Giants fans worldwide.

Licensed Lawrence Taylor t shirts are produced by companies such as Fanatics, which holds major NFL licensing agreements. The NFL Players Inc. group manages the right of publicity for current and retired players, including Taylor. Sellers must comply with league and player licensing requirements to legally use trademarks, names, and images. Unauthorized reproductions may violate intellectual property laws and league regulations.

Lawrence Taylor Legacy and Merchandise Demand

Lawrence Taylor is widely regarded as one of the greatest defensive players in NFL history. He won the NFL Defensive Player of the Year award three times and was in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 1999. His career stats include 1,089 tackles, 142.5 sacks, and two NFL championships with the New York Giants. These achievements drive sustained demand for Lawrence Taylor t shirts among sports fans.
